Iraqi Desert Storm Beret
I usually forget about my war but every once in a while I'll do a search to see what comes up. Found this in the last one and learned a bit about Iraqi beret badges in the process. There are a lot of berets listed as Desert Storm but most are later. Correct badges like this one have the three stars going vertical. After Desert Storm the badge was changed to the stars going horizontal. This one actually has paperwork which wasn't listed at time of purchase so it was a bit of a surprise.
